In the fast-paced world of consumer technology, timing is often just as important as technical specifications. For many shoppers, the "best" time to buy electronics is not a single date but a series of windows throughout the year where retail cycles, product launches, and seasonal demand align to lower prices. Beyond the winter holidays, "Christmas in July" has become a secondary peak. Driven largely by Amazon Prime Day, this mid-summer event forces competitors like Walmart and Best Buy to slash prices on TVs and small gadgets. It is important to remember that the lowest price isn't always the best value. Some "doorbuster" deals on Black Friday involve "derivative models"—lower-quality versions of products manufactured specifically for holiday sales with fewer features or cheaper components.
